In March, 2023, a ranking released by Zeta Alpha, an American industry research institution, made many domestic artificial intelligence (AI) practitioners feel very excited. Among the top 100 cited AI papers in the world, China’s Defiance Technology, a unicorn enterprise founded by three Tsinghua "Yao Ban" students, ranked second only to the "popular star" of international artificial intelligence.
As early as before the artificial intelligence surge, they embarked on the journey of sending artificial intelligence technology from the laboratory to real life, and finally let China’s artificial intelligence industry stand on the world-class track.

Change is opportunity. In 2011, three Tsinghua "Xueba" jointly founded Defiance Technology, becoming the earliest artificial intelligence startup company in China. However, AI’s extremely attractive technical vision cannot directly bring the future to the front. Young geeks who are full of blood just broke into the society and were splashed with cold water. "Where is a technology startup company in China?" An investor left a word to Inch and Tang Wenbin, and the tone was beyond doubt.
The stereotype of investors was faced by China science and technology entrepreneurs more than ten years ago. At that time, most of the capital’s eager eyes on entrepreneurial projects focused on mobile Internet applications and business model innovation that could become popular overnight. There are few precedents for the success of technology entrepreneurship, and as for artificial intelligence, few people care.
Despite this, several young people firmly believe in their own judgment-mastering the underlying technology, they will embrace the "BRIC" that will shine sooner or later.
Yinqi and the team worked around the clock to train the visual recognition cloud platform with a billion-level algorithm every day through the "neuron-like deep learning algorithm" to accelerate the self-repair of the platform. Just like sea tactics, the more data systematically analyzed, the more accurate the calculation and identification results will be.
Only one year later, the false recognition rate of the contemptuous visual service platform Face++ has dropped to one in ten thousand, which is equivalent to growing into an 18-year-old adult’s brain in three years in the direction of visual recognition. By the second half of 2014, its recognition rate has reached 97.27%, and it has won the champion of three international evaluations, namely FDDB, 300-W and LFW, exceeding the recognition rate of Facebook of 97.25%. Patiently cross the "Death Valley"
In March 2016, Google’s artificial intelligence Go software AlphaGo beat the former world Go champion Li Shishi, and artificial intelligence became a household name overnight. Startups based on artificial intelligence technology have suddenly become hot. In 2017, Defiance Technology received $460 million in Series C financing.
However, the growing pains also follow-more players, more expensive research and development, but less technology.
Yinqi realized that after the early honeymoon period, the industry was entering the deep water area. The application of artificial intelligence technology will be the first to mature in the enterprise market, and the key battle for artificial intelligence start-ups to cross the "Valley of Death" will also start on this "battlefield". Attack the enterprise market!
However, compared with the consumer market with high outbreak and high growth, the enterprise market is a "bitter" business. No matter in the fields of finance, security or supply chain, every industry is occupied by giants who have been deeply cultivated for many years. For a group of young geeks, it is not easy to gnaw such "hard bones".
Shortly after entering the security industry, Tang Wenbin, as the company’s chief technology officer, found that many face recognition systems obtain information from the video shot by the front-end ordinary camera and then identify it, so it is difficult to store and transmit the video. "Why not directly make a smart cameras that can be identified immediately? It must be very valuable. "
Just do it. A high-end smart cameras comes out, which is not only equipped with a self-developed intelligent identification system, but also uses a sensor with leading performance, an expensive processor and even a seven-color shell.
However, when communicating with users, the team found that these products, which are cool enough in terms of technical indicators and appearance, did not meet the demand. Customers in an industry require power consumption within 3 watts, while their smart cameras consume nearly 18 watts. The cost of a piece of equipment of 10,000 yuan was even more unacceptable in the market environment at that time.
"Looking for nails with a hammer." This experience is a detour that many companies that started with technology have gone through. On the long March of technological entrepreneurship, there is never a shortcut, and the only way is to keep going.
Go to the nearest line of demand-
Standing in an e-commerce platform warehouse with a temperature of minus 10℃ and an area of 20,000 square meters, Tang Wenbin and Yinqi found that any air conditioner and heating can’t play any role here. In this environment, the total walking distance of the picking team can reach 30 to 40 kilometers at the end of the day. Is there any way to improve the efficiency of warehousing and logistics? Since then, in this large warehouse, more than 500 robots of three types of partners have been ignored and worked together, which has improved the efficiency of personnel by 40%.
Go to the "battlefield" where the demand for technology is the most urgent-
At the beginning of 2020, the epidemic broke out in COVID-19, and the emergency project team headed by Yinqi was set up on the first day of New Year’s Day. More than 100 people joined the research and development of artificial intelligence temperature measurement scheme. Ten days later, Ming Ji AI intelligent temperature measuring system was officially delivered for trial operation, and it was applied to Beijing’s major subways, supermarkets, hospitals and other scenes.
Nowadays, in more than 100 domestic cities, more than 10 countries and regions, ignoring urban Internet of Things solutions is always exerting wisdom for urban operation; In the smart warehouses of major enterprises, the smart pallet four-way car with small body and standard load of 1500 kg has been put into battle; Hundreds of millions of smart phones around the world have used the contemptuous device unlocking and computational photography solutions …
The technical vision of "using artificial intelligence to benefit the public" of young geeks 12 years ago has blossomed in fields, factories, mines, schools and communities.

Beijing becomes the first city of AI.
By October 2022, there were 1,048 artificial intelligence core enterprises in Beijing, accounting for 29% of the total number of artificial intelligence enterprises in China, ranking first in the country, and more than 30 artificial intelligence unicorn enterprises have been born.
Twenty-four enterprises in China have been approved to build a new generation of national artificial intelligence open innovation platform, of which 10 enterprises are headquartered in Beijing.
There are more than 40,000 core technical talents in the field of artificial intelligence in Beijing, accounting for 60% of the country; The number of artificial intelligence papers published ranks first in the country; Among the top 100 institutions in the world in terms of the number of patents granted, there are 30 Beijing-based institutions.
The two major industries, medical health and information technology, are becoming the "twin engines" of Beijing’s sophisticated economy under the cross-integration of artificial intelligence platform technology. In 2022, the related output value of Beijing artificial intelligence industry is estimated to be about 227 billion yuan.
Hard technology is written into the five-year plan
On March 12, 2021, the 14th Five-Year Plan for National Economic and Social Development and the Outline of Long-term Goals in 2035 was officially released, in which it was specifically mentioned that it was necessary to enhance the characteristics of "hard technology" in science and technology innovation board and enhance the function of Growth Enterprise Market in serving growth-oriented innovative and entrepreneurial enterprises.
In November, 2021, the Plan for the Construction of Beijing International Science and Technology Innovation Center during the Tenth Five-Year Plan period also proposed to carry out pilot projects of equity investment and venture capital share transfer in depth to guide early investment, hard technology investment and long-term investment; Support the development of market-oriented and specialized hard technology incubators, promote the verification and maturation of scientific and technological achievements, and quickly realize transformation and industrialization.
Hard technology refers to the key core technology that needs long-term R&D investment, has a high technical threshold, is difficult to be copied and imitated, and has a significant supporting role for economic and social development. Hard technology is at the high end of the global value chain, which has the characteristics of high intellectual property barriers, high capital investment, high information intensity, high added value of products and high industrial control, and is an important symbol to measure a country’s core competitiveness. At present, the representative fields of hard technology include photoelectric chips, artificial intelligence, aerospace, biotechnology, information technology, new materials, new energy, intelligent manufacturing and so on.(Sun Qiru)
